Blades Trade Braid to Kamloops

Published on October 8, 2015 under Western Hockey League (WHL)
Saskatoon Blades News Release


SASKATOON - The Saskatoon Blades have traded 1997-born forward Chasetan Braid to the Kamloops Blazers in exchange for a 5th round pick in the 2017 WHL Bantam Draft.

Braid was originally listed by the Blades in February of 2013 and made his debut last season with the club. In 60 career games with the Blades, Braid has two goals, four assists, and 53 penalty minutes.
